Assessment Comments
Assessment is based on surveys by DNR Fisheries and results of fish tissue (RAFT) monitoring in 1994.
Basis for Assessment
SUMMARY: The Class A (primary contact recreation) uses were considered "not assessed." The Class B(LW) aquatic life uses were assessed as "partially supported." Fish consumption uses were assessed as fully supported. EXPLANATION: The Class A uses were considered "not assessed" due to a lack of information on levels of indicator bacteria for this lake. The assessment of support for the Class B(LW) uses was changed from "fully supported / threatened" to "partially supported" based on the recommendation of the DNR Fisheries Bureau. Monitoring of winter levels of dissolved oxygen suggests that a water quality problem exists despite winter aeration. The primary impacts appear to be excessive growth of aquatic plants (macrophytes) and organic enrichment; siltation is not believed to be a problem. Fish consumption uses remained assessed as "fully supported" based on results of EPA/DNR fish tissue (RAFT) monitoring in 1994 (see assessment for the 1998 report above). This lake is scheduled to be sampled as part of the ISU/DNR lake water quality monitoring project.
